    jQuery Source Code Interpretation

    jQuery Source Code Interpretation

    jQuery source code parsing

    jQuery- is a collection of experimental frontend techniques and creative demonstrations centered around JavaScript, CSS, and browser behavior, created by the same author behind iCSS. The project focuses on showcasing clever implementations, visual tricks, and unconventional solutions that expand how developers think about classic web technologies. It serves primarily as an educational playground where developers can study practical code examples and learn nuanced behaviors of the DOM, animations, and browser rendering. ...

    LogAnal is a quick hack to parse Apache Log Files and produce graphical and textual web server statistics. Works in incremental mode only. Supports Templates for the output HTML, as well as localization (defaults to English).

    A quick and easy CGI Perl firewall log parser that gives an up to date look at logs created by ipchains. It diplays the firewall logs as a HTML page.
